JorgeB Posted June 14, 2020 Posted June 14, 2020 13 hours ago, cooperes said: suggest its a software problem or a configuration problem? The only way I can think of this being a configuration problem would be if you were using VMs and by mistake passing-though the USB controller where the flash drive is to the VM, other than that this is a hardware problem, flash drive would be the prime suspect, but since you already tried a new one... I guess you could try a different one before trying a different board. 1 Quote
JorgeB Posted June 14, 2020 Posted June 14, 2020 53 minutes ago, cooperes said: More failures tonight... Flash drive continues to drop: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: usb 1-3: USB disconnect, device number 2 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: print_req_error: I/O error, dev sda, sector 2049 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: Buffer I/O error on dev sda1, logical block 1, lost async page write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: print_req_error: I/O error, dev sda, sector 31413 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: Buffer I/O error on dev sda1, logical block 29365, lost async page write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: print_req_error: I/O error, dev sda, sector 468180 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: Buffer I/O error on dev sda1, logical block 466132, lost async page write Jun 13 23:40:43 plex kernel: usb 1-3: new high-speed USB device number 3 using ehci-pci Jun 13 23:40:43 plex emhttpd: error: put_config_idx, 619: No such file or directory (2): fopen: /boot/config/shares/Media.cfg Jun 13 23:40:43 plex emhttpd: error: put_config_idx, 619: No such file or directory (2): fopen: /boot/config/shares/appdata.cfg It's either a flash problem, a USB/board problem, or someone is removing it of the server. 1 Quote
